Bard College at Simon’s Rock

Bard College at Simon’s Rock is a private, residential liberal arts college located in Great Barrington, Massachusetts, and is the founding institution of the Early College movement in the United States. Its unique mission is to serve as a college for students who are ready to begin their higher education immediately after the 10th or 11th grade, bypassing the final years of high school. It offers a rigorous, interdisciplinary, discussion-based liberal arts and sciences curriculum designed for thoughtful, exceptionally motivated young scholars. The focus is not merely on acceleration, but on providing a challenging academic environment where students are taken seriously as active participants in serious intellectual work.

The college was officially founded in 1964 by Elizabeth Blodgett Hall, a former headmistress at Concord Academy, who believed that the last two years of high school were often redundant and limiting for many bright teenagers. The college opened its doors in 1966, initially offering a four-year program that combined high school and college, and was the only residential early college of its kind for decades. A major turning point occurred in 1979 when the college was acquired by Bard College. This partnership provided academic and financial strength, integrating core Bard intellectual traditions like the Writing and Thinking Workshops and the Senior Project into the college's unique early-entry model, ensuring its continued leadership in redefining the transition from high school to college.
